Water Removal Service: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ean up and fix yourself |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ry out and repair |
| Leaky roof with water damage |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air and prevent further damage |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air |
| Severe flooding with extensive damage |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to restore your property to its former state |
With water removal service, it’s essential to choose the right option for your specific situation. While some small issues may be DIY-friendly, more complex problems need the expertise and equipment of a professional.
Water Removal Service Cost In The 2451 Area
The cost of water removal service can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 2451 area.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a free estimate for the work.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of drying equipment needed, number of technicians required |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, number of technicians required |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, number of technicians required |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, number of technicians required |
| Customized Solution | $1,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, number of technicians required |
The cost of water removal service can v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a free estimate for the work.

How long does it take to dry out a flooded basement?
The length of time it takes to dry out a flooded basement can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ment used. In general,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to dry out a basement, but this can be longer or shorter depending on the specifics of your situation.
